Sujeewa Prasanna Arachchi is a prominent contemporary Sri Lankan author celebrated for his prolific contribution to Sinhala literature, particularly in the romance, drama, and social commentary genres. Known for a narrative style that weaves together personal emotional struggles with broader cultural dynamics, his work has secured a lasting legacy in the hearts of modern readers. Popular Novels and Notable Series
Arachchi is best known for his long-running series that explore character development over multiple installments.
The Warsha Series: Often cited as his most significant work, this series includes titles such as Warsha 01, Warsha 03, Warsha 07, and Warsha 11. The series is praised for its realistic portrayal of Sri Lankan society and its complex central character, Warsha.
The Denuwan Series: A multi-volume collection featuring titles like Denuwan 1, Denuwan 2, and Denuwan 3, these books frequently span over 600 pages each, offering deep dives into their characters' lives.
Bonda Meedum: This popular series of novels gained even wider fame through its adaptation into a highly-rated television teledrama on the Independent Television Network (ITN). If you are searching for PDFs, you should
